Welcome to the forum, GameOnMax! You’ve highlighted some key features for a gaming smartphone. To add, consider also checking for:

  • Good cooling systems to prevent overheating during long sessions.
  • Fast charging support so you can quickly get back to gaming.
  • High touch sampling rate for more responsive controls.
  • Ample RAM (at least 12GB) to handle multitasking smoothly.
  • Customizable gaming modes or software optimizations.

Great points, @GameOnMax! To expand on your answer, here are some key features to consider when choosing the best gaming smartphone:

  1. High Refresh Rate Display: Look for screens with at least 120Hz refresh rate for smooth gameplay. AMOLED panels also offer vibrant colors and better contrast.

  2. Powerful Processor: Flagship chipsets like the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 or Apple’s A17 Pro deliver top gaming performance and future-proof your device.

  3. RAM & Storage: Aim for at least 8GB of RAM and 128GB of storage. More RAM helps with multitasking and running demanding games smoothly.

  4. Large Battery & Fast Charging: Gaming can drain your battery quickly, so a 5,000mAh battery or higher is ideal. Fast charging (65W or more) gets you back in the game quickly.

  5. Efficient Cooling System: Gaming phones like the ASUS ROG Phone series or Lenovo Legion include advanced cooling to prevent overheating during long sessions.

  6. Customizable Gaming Features: Look for features like shoulder triggers, customizable game modes, and software optimizations for gaming.

  7. Audio & Haptics: Dual front-facing speakers and strong vibration feedback enhance immersion.

  8. 5G Connectivity: For online multiplayer games, a 5G-capable phone ensures low latency and fast downloads.

Popular gaming smartphones in 2024 include the ASUS ROG Phone 8, RedMagic 9 Pro, and the Black Shark 6 Pro. Each offers unique gaming-centric features, so consider your budget and preferred games.
